This position supports undergraduate summer research in mathematics as part of an NSF-funded project in abstract, applied, and computational harmonic analysis. Students may work on one of two research directions: 1. One project focuses on the classification problem for five-interval wavelet sets. This includes computational and theoretical work related to finite unions of intervals that tile the real line under both translation and dilation. Possible tasks include building a web-based visualization tool for candidate wavelet sets, testing geometric tiling conditions, exploring examples computationally, and assisting with classification work through computation, pattern detection, symbolic experimentation, and mathematical reasoning. 2. A second project focuses on a four-point subproblem related to the HRT Conjecture. This work combines advanced mathematical reading with the use of large language models and the Lean proof assistant to help organize, formalize, and verify mathematical arguments. Students in this direction will contribute to a careful workflow at the interface of abstract mathematics, symbolic logic, and computation. Preferred Qualifications We are especially interested in strong undergraduate students who are mathematically mature, reliable, creative, and excited to work on challenging open problems. Preference will be given to students with strength in proof-based mathematics. Some computational or programming experience is helpful, though not required for every aspect of the work. Students interested in the HRT project should be willing to learn formal proof methods and work carefully with symbolic and computational tools. Relevant backgrounds may include real analysis, abstract algebra, harmonic analysis, number theory, mathematical computing, formal methods, theoretical computer science, and scientific writing.
